Abstract :
Based on the irreversible demagnetization of the permanent magnet (PM) in vehicle permanent magnet motor (PMM), the demagnetization mechanism of PM is presented and the main factor of vehicle high density PMM demagnetization is analyzed in this paper. The design, analysis and optimization method of anti-demagnetization of PMM at home and abroad are proposed. The advantages and disadvantages of anti-demagnetization analysis method are investigated. At the same time, the solutions and research directions are pointed out, and these works will provide useful information for anti-demagnetization design and contribute to the development of the anti-demagnetization technology for vehicle PMM.
